What is a Rollator?
A rollator is a mobility aid geared up with wheels, hand brakes, and often, a seat for resting. Unlike traditional walkers, which need lifting, rollators offer assistance while permitting users to push or glide the walker forward with ease. This feature makes rollators particularly advantageous for users with minimal upper body strength or endurance.

When considering a rollator, it's necessary to assess different factors to guarantee it satisfies the user's needs. Below are numerous key considerations:
Weight Capacity: Different designs have various weight limitations. Make sure to choose one that accommodates the user's weight.Size and Portability: Consider the dimensions of the rollator and whether it can be quickly transported, particularly if the user takes a trip frequently.Wheel Size: Larger wheels are more suitable for outdoor use on irregular surfaces, whereas smaller wheels are better for indoor use.Braking System: Ensure the rollator has a reputable braking system that is easy to run.Seat Height and Comfort: If the rollator consists of a seat, examine its height and convenience level to make sure appropriateness for the user.Storage Options: Look for rollators with built-in storage services to enhance benefit.Design and Color: While functionality is essential, aesthetic appeals can likewise contribute in user satisfaction.Kinds of Rollators

How do I understand what size rollator I need?
It's important to consider the user's height and weight when picking a rollator. An excellent guideline of thumb is to have the handgrips level with the user's wrists when standing easily.
2. Can I use a rollator outdoors?
Yes, many rollators are created for outdoor use with bigger wheels and robust frames. Ensure that the model you select is ideal for the terrain where it will be used.
3. Are rollators simple to put together?
Most rollators come fully assembled or require minimal assembly. Instructions are normally consisted of, making it easy to use.
4. Can I take my rollator on public transport?
Lots of public transportation options accommodate rollators, but it's always advisable to inspect the specific policies and guarantee the rollator can easily be folded or steered within the space offered.
5. How frequently should I check my rollator for maintenance?
Routine checks (at least regular monthly) must be produced wear and tear, brakes functionality, and wheel stability to make sure safe use.
